Ingredients for Valentine’s Day Cheesecake
Here’s what you’ll need to make this dreamy Valentine’s Day cheesecake! Gather these ingredients, and you’re well on your way to creating something really special.
- 2 cups graham cracker crumbs
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 4 packages (8 oz each) cream cheese, softened
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 3 large eggs
- 1 cup sour cream
- 1/2 cup fresh strawberries, pureed
Make sure your cream cheese is softened—this is super important for that silky smooth texture! And don’t skip the fresh strawberries; they add such a lovely sweetness and color. Trust me, you’ll want to savor every bite!
How to Prepare Valentine’s Day Cheesecake
Now that you have all your ingredients ready, let’s get started on this scrumptious journey to cheesecake heaven! I promise, following these steps will lead you to a dessert that’s sure to impress.
Preheat the Oven
First things first, you’ll want to preheat your oven to 325°F (160°C). This step is crucial because it ensures that your cheesecake bakes evenly and comes out with that perfect creamy texture. While the oven is warming up, you can get everything else prepped!
Prepare the Crust
In a mixing b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s and melted butter. I like to use my hands to really mix it in, but a fork works just as well! You want it to be moist enough that it holds together when pressed. Once you’ve got that buttery goodness ready, grab your 9-inch springform pan. Press the mixture firmly into the bottom to create a solid crust. It should be a nice even layer, so don’t be shy! A little elbow grease goes a long way here!
Make the Filling
In a large bowl, beat the softened cream cheese and granulated sugar together until it’s smooth as silk. This is where the magic starts to happen! Once it’s all creamy, add in the vanilla extract and mix until well combined. Now, here’s a little tip: add the eggs one at a time, mixing gently after each addition. This helps keep the filling light and fluffy. After all the eggs are in, stir in the sour cream and that luscious strawberry puree. Can you smell the sweetness already? It’s heavenly!
Bake the Cheesecake
Pour your filling over the crust, spreading it out evenly. Now, pop it into the oven and let it bake for about 55-60 minutes. You’ll know it’s done when the center is set but still has a slight jiggle—this is key! Once it’s out of the oven, let it cool at room temperature for a bit before transferring it to the fridge. And here’s the hard part: you’ll need to chill it for at least 4 hours (or overnight if you can wait!). This chilling time is essential for that rich, creamy texture we all love. Tips for Success
Now that you’re on your way to creating a stunning Valentine’s Day cheesecake, let me share some of my top tips to ensure it turns out perfectly every time! Trust me, these little secrets can make a big difference.
- Use a Water Bath: If you want your cheesecake to have that ultra-smooth texture, consider using a water bath. Just wrap the outside of your springform pan in aluminum foil to prevent leaks, then place it in a larger baking dish filled with hot water before baking. This gentle steam helps regulate the temperature and prevents cracks!
- Cool Gradually: After baking, let your cheesecake cool in the oven with the door slightly ajar for about an hour. This gradual cooling helps avoid sudden temperature changes that can cause cracks.
- Chill Properly: I can’t stress enough how important it is to chill your cheesecake for at least 4 hours, but overnight is even better! This helps the flavors meld and gives it that rich, creamy consistency.
- Storage: If you have leftovers (which is rare in my house!), store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 5 days. You can also wrap individual slices tightly in plastic wrap and freeze them for up to 2 months—perfect for a sweet treat whenever the mood strikes!

FAQ About Valentine’s Day Cheesecake
Got some questions about this delightful Valentine’s Day cheesecake? No worries! I’m here to help you navigate through some common queries so you can bake with confidence and enjoy every creamy bite!
Can I use a different crust?
Absolutely! While a classic graham cracker crust is my go-to, you can mix things up with alternative crusts. Try using crushed Oreo cookies for a chocolatey twist or even a nut crust made from almonds or pecans for a gluten-free option. Just remember, the crust is the foundation of your cheesecake, so choose something that complements those rich flavors beautifully!
How do I know when my cheesecake is done?
Great question! You’ll want to look for a cheesecake that’s set around the edges while still having a slight jiggle in the center—think of it like a gentle wave! It should not be completely firm; that slight jiggle means it’ll be creamy once it cools. If you want to be extra sure, you can gently insert a toothpick into the center. If it comes out mostly clean (a little filling is okay), you’re good to go!
Can I make this cheesecake ahead of time?
You bet! In fact, I often make this cheesecake a day or two in advance. Just be sure to wrap it well and refrigerate it once it’s fully chilled. This allows the flavors to meld beautifully, making it even tastier when you serve it. Just remember to top it just before serving for that fresh and vibrant touch!
What toppings go well with Valentine’s Day cheesecake?
Oh, the toppings are where you can really get creative! Fresh strawberries are a classic choice since they pair beautifully with the cheesecake’s creaminess. You can also drizzle some chocolate ganache or a luscious caramel sauce for an indulgent treat. Feeling adventurous? Try a mix of berries, or even a dollop of whipped cream to add a light, airy touch. The options are endless, and they all add that perfect finishing touch!
